Felipe VI accumulates 35 international trips in his first 1,000 days of reign

 

The Diplomat. 14/03/2017

 

Felipe VI has been reigning for one thousand days in which he has promoted the transparency and austerity of the Crown, he has promoted its opening to all sectors of society and he has faced institutional challenges, such as a long and unprecedented political standstill and the growing pro-independent bet in Catalonia.

 

His international agenda in this period has already accumulated 35 trips since he visited the Vatican, barely ten days after his proclamation. Among these trips are two Ibero-American Summits, the last three UN Assemblies General and three visits of State (France, Mexico and Portugal), which will soon be five with those to Japan and the United Kingdom, as well as the meeting with Barack Obama at the Oval Office of the White House.
